    all i can say is that if stinks upstairs then you bet your ass the shit has burst out of the tank below. what i mean is: if it happens at the highest level of our government then it also occurs at the most basic level of our society. and schools are no exception.

    but let's not fight it head-on. we'll surely lose that way. what we can do is to teach our kids. let's not pin all our hopes to an institution that we know is run by human beings. as such, that institution is always flawed and subject to errors.

    let's teach our kids to be smart, not just intelligent; to learn what not to follow as much as (if not more than) what should be followed; to be principled; to have hopes and dreams--and work hard for them the proper way.

    it's just sad that no one from inside has yet done anything to remedy the situation. but who knows, the solution could already be forthcoming.

    the best thing i got out of shs was not my grades or the prestige (blah blah) but my experience--both the good and the not-so-good. at least shs taught me how to think for myself. i have the school to thank for that.
